凝望长空 发表于 2012-01-14 20:00

js 时间格式化


js 时间格式化






js对时间格式化方式

代码如下:function formatDate(formatStr, fdate)
{
var fTime, fStr = 'ymdhis';
if (!formatStr)
formatStr= "y-m-d h:i:s";
if (fdate)
fTime = new Date(fdate);
else
fTime = new Date();
var formatArr = [
fTime.getFullYear().toString(),
(fTime.getMonth()+1).toString(),
fTime.getDate().toString(),
fTime.getHours().toString(),
fTime.getMinutes().toString(),
fTime.getSeconds().toString()
]
for (var i=0; i<formatArr.length; i++)
{
formatStr = formatStr.replace(fStr.charAt(i), formatArr);
}
return formatStr;
} 使用时代码:var z_Date = new Date(date);
var str = formatDate(null,z_Date.getTime());
alert(str);

梦境照进现实 发表于 2012-01-19 22:29

谢谢分享

sychangchun 发表于 2012-01-25 23:17

好资料啊,谢谢分享啊。
页: [1]
查看完整版本: js 时间格式化